            Most of what we do is adverse - but we do not do help to buy.
 We have seen quite a shift in the last 3 months, we are finding that if you have a 20-30% deposit, you can actually get better deals than you could previously if your adverse is over 2-3 years old.
 Less than 3 years old adverse and you typically need a 20-25% deposit where as previously you might have got away with a 15% deposit and rates have gone up.
 But we had 3 adverse cases agreed last week and we are hoping to have another one agreed by Friday.I am a Mortgage AdviserYou should note that this site doesn't check my status as a mortgage adviser, so you need to take my word for it.
